The online insertion and removal (OIR) facility detected a newly inserted transceiver
Explanation
module for the interface specified in the error message.
An initialization failure occurred for the transceiver module for the interface specified
Explanation
in the error message. This condition could be caused by software, firmware, or hardware problem.
As a result of the error, the module is disabled.
Try reseating the module. Hardware replacement should not occur first
Recommended Action
occurrence. Before requesting hardware replacement, review troubleshooting logs with a technical
support representative.

SFP Module Replacement
Resolution
Remove the SFP module and replace it
with a Cisco-approved module. Use the
errdisable recovery cause
gbic-invalid global configuration
command to verify the port status, and
enter a time interval to recover from the
error-disable state.
Remove the SFP module from the
switch and replace it with a
Cisco-approved module. Use the
errdisable recovery cause
gbic-invalid global configuration
command to verify the port status, and
enter a time interval to recover from the
error-disable state.
Verify that the SFP module is not
installed upside down.
Remove the SFP module. Inspect for
physical damage to the connector, the
module, and the module slot.
Replace the SFP module with a known
good SFP module.
Run adapter card diagnostic utility and
wait 30 seconds for the port LED to turn
green.
